Trekking
|
Himachal
|
|
There
are four mountain ranges running almost parallel to one another in
Himachal Pradesh and thus creating charming and beautiful valleys
and passes suitable for trekking. There are numerous passes on
these ranges which connect the valleys, making good trekkking
routes for all types of trekkers. One can cross one pass and
return over the other or proceed further to cross another on the
next range.
|
 |
|
|
There are about two dozen passes on the
Dhauladhar, a
dozen over the Pirpanjal range and 8-10 such passes over the Great
Himalayan range to cross over to the Zanskar valley. Himachal
offers a virtual bonanza for trekkers.
